One of Japan's most lavishly decorated shrines

Nikko Tosho-gu is a shrine dedicated to Tokugawa Ieyasu who the established Edo Shougunate. It was constructed in 1617 and further expanded by Tokugawa Iemitsu from 1634, the third shogun. Tokugawa Ieyasu’s remains are entombed here. It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
